Butt Chicken
Posted by FootsieBear at recipegoldmine.com April 2001
We do this quite frequently around here. In fact my neighbor brought over
2 of them yesterday, and they were falling off the bone tender!
I just use any combination of seasonings that strike my fancy at the time
(my favorite blend is called Everglades Seasoning but it's fairly regional).
Set the chicken on top of an open can of beer with the legs and wings hanging
freely (in other words don't tuck the wings under like you would for baking
it (you can also use cola, ginger ale, 7-Up, Dr. Pepper etc.) and place on grill
(indirect heat is best) and cover with lid. It usually takes about an hour depending
on how hot the grill is. but the easiest way to tell, other than a meat thermometer,
is the wings will sort of rise up and look like they're waving "Hi I'm done!"
